China's decision to close its doors to the Argentine National Team following controversy surrounding Messi's absence from an Inter Miami fixture in Hong Kong led to the cancellation of two scheduled friendly matches against Ivory Coast and Nigeria. However, the United States has stepped in to host Argentina, offering an opportunity for Scaloni's side to continue their preparations on American soil ahead of the 2024 Copa America.

Argentina's itinerary includes two friendlies in March. The first match will see them face El Salvador at Philadelphia's Lincoln Financial Field on March 22. Four days later, they will take on Costa Rica at the Memorial Coliseum in Los Angeles on March 26. However, Messi's international duties mean he will miss Inter Miami's clash against the New York Red Bulls on March 23 at Red Bull Arena.

Garnacho has been in inspirational form for Manchester United in February which led Scaloni to call him for the next set of friendlies. He scored a brace against West Ham in a 3-0 win and also set up Rasmus Hojlund against Luton Town at Kenilworth Road to churn out a narrow 2-1 win victory. In addition to Garnacho's call-up, Scaloni has also included Valentín Barco and Facundo Buonanotte of Brighton in the squad, further diversifying the team's talent pool and providing opportunities for emerging players to showcase their abilities on the international stage. Meanwhile, experienced campaigners like Liverpool's Alexis Mac Allister, Manchester City's Julian Alvarez and Chelsea's Enzo Fernandez will also cross the Atlantic to join their national teammates.
ARGENTINA SQUAD IN FULL
Goalkeepers: Franco Armani, Walter Benítez, Emiliano Martínez
Defenders: German Pezzella, Nehuen Pérez, Nicolas Otamendi Cristian Romero, Nicolás Tagliafico Marcos Senesi, Nahuel Molina, Valentín Barco
Midfielders: Ezequiel Palacios, Rodrigo De Paul, Leandro Paredes, Alexis Mac Allister, Enzo Fernandez, Giovani Lo Celso , Nicolás Gonzalez, Facundo Buonanotte
Forwards: Alejandro Garnacho, Valentín Carboni, Angel Di María, Lionel Messi, Julian Alvarez, Lautaro Martínez, Paulo Dybala
